Bong Joon-Ho Among Korean Artists Calling For Probe Into ‘Parasite’ Actor Lee Sun-Kyun’s Death

South Korean arts and culture organizations, artists and filmmakers, including Bong Joon-ho, have joined together to call for an investigation into the circumstances surrounding the death of actor Lee Sun-kyun. Lee, whose credits include Bong’s Oscar winning Parasite, died last month in an apparent suicide at the age of 48.

FIFTY FIFTY’s Keena teases new music from the girl group

K-pop girl group FIFTY FIFTY has expressed her plans to continue releasing music through the group.In a press release earlier this week per The Korea Times, Keena shared that she is “gearing up to share more love, hoping we can walk this path together in the future.” The rapper is currently the only remaining member of the group following a dispute between its former members and label Attrakt last year.The label previously announced in November 2023 that it plans to add new members to FIFTY FIFTY, and for the group to continue as a four-member act. Keena echoed this sentiment in her statement, saying: “Once again, I’m preparing to entertain and demonstrate my hard work with FIFTY FIFTY’s songs.”Attrakt also reportedly expressed its intention once again to search for new members for FIFTY FIFTY, adding that “this opportunity has been made possible by Keena’s return [to the agency].”The rapper had notably co-written some of the group’s past songs, including their debut single ‘Higher’ and the Korean version of their Tiktok viral hit ‘Cupid’.The girl group first debuted in November 2022 with the line-up of members Saena, Sio, Keena and Aran.

ASTRO’s Cha Eun-woo to make his solo debut this year

ASTRO‘s Cha Eun-woo is working on his debut solo record, Fantagio Music has confirmed.On January 9, SpoTV News reported that Cha Eun-woo is preparing to release his first solo album in the first half of 2024. Fantagio later confirmed the news via Star1, adding that the ASTRO member aims to unveil songs from the upcoming project at this solo fan concert this February.“Cha Eun-woo is preparing his first solo album with the goal of releasing it in the first half of 2024,” the K-pop agency said, as translated by Soompi.

Here are the nominees of the 31st Hanteo Music Awards

NewJeans, ENHYPEN, aespa and more.The 31st Hanteo Music Awards, which will celebrate the best of K-pop in 2023, is set to take place on February 17 and February 18 at Dongdaemun Design Plaza in Seoul.A total of 50 acts have been nominated for Artist of the Year, including the likes of girl groups NewJeans, (G)I-DLE and aespa, as well as boyband SEVENTEEN, SHINee and ENHYPEN. The criteria for this award will be based on a mix of the Hanteo Global score (50 per cent), global voting score (20 per cent) and judging score (30 per cent)Meanwhile, 10 boyband are up for Rookie of the Year (Male), including KOZ Entertainment’s BOYNEXTDOOR, SM Entertainment newcomers RIIZE and Boys Planet winners ZEROBASEONE.Six girl group have been nominated for Rookie of the Year (Female).

GOT7’s BamBam says he’ll “never go to award shows again” after technical issues at 2024 Seoul Music Awards

GOT7 singer BamBam has spoken out about the technical difficulties he faced during his performance at the 2024 Seoul Music Awards, saying he will “never go to award shows again”.This year’s Seoul Music Awards were held yesterday (January 2) at Bangkok’s Rajamangala Stadium, during which prizes were presented to winners and special performances were staged. The ceremony was also streamed live for global audiences to watch.As part of the performing line-up, GOT7 member BamBam took to the stage for a special mash-up of his solo singles ‘Pandora’, ‘Sour & Sweet’ and ‘Ribbon’.

Here’s a first look at Netflix’s ‘Badland Hunters’, starring Don Lee

Badland Hunters, starring Don Lee.Badland Hunters will follow Don Lee as Nam San, a hunter in a post-apocalyptic Seoul who has to navigate the treacherous wilderness of a world where chaos reigns supreme.Lee will be joined by actors Lee Hee-jun, Lee Jun-young, Roh Jeong-eui and An Ji-hye. Meanwhile, Badland Hunters will be directed by Heo Myeong-haeng, who previously worked as the stunts director on films such as The Roundup: No Way Out, Jung_E and more.The teaser for the upcoming Netflix film previews the desolate yet captivating landscape of post-apocalyptic Seoul.

‘Past Lives’ Star Teo Yoo to Join ‘The Recruit’ Season 2 Cast

Caroline Brew editor Teo Yoo (“Past Lives,” “Love to Hate You”) has been cast as a series regular in Season 2 of Netflix‘s “The Recruit.” He will play a highly skilled South Korean NIS agent “with a subversive sense of humor and willing to go to any lengths to protect those he cares about,” according to the release. Per the official logline, Season 2 of “The Recruit” finds Noah Centineo‘s CIA lawyer, Owen Hendricks, “pulled into a life-threatening espionage situation in South Korea, only to realize that the bigger threat just might be coming from inside the Agency.” Yoo was recently nominated for the best lead performance Independent Spirit Award via his role in Celine Song’s “Past Lives,” starring opposite Greta Lee.

K-Pop FAST Channel Launch Backed by Static Waves, Arirang TV

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Static Waves, a Netherlands-based channels and content distribution company, has teamed with Korea’s Arirang TV to launch K-Wave, which they claim will be the world’s first free ad-supported television (FAST) channel dedicated to Korean popular music (K-pop). K-Wave will launch in January in the U.S. Europe and Asia via Zeasn, a platform which distributes to TCL, HiSense TV+ and Vestel brands of connected TVs pre-installed with Zeasn’s Whale OS. Its content will include: original series, live concerts, documentaries on K-pop stars, music and fashion trends, dance instruction videos and behind-the-scenes clips. To propel its Korean expansion, Static Waves has established a local business entity, Static Waves Korea, based in Seoul.

Korea Box Office: ‘Napoleon’ Opens in Third Place, as ‘12.12: The Day’ Hits $50 Million

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Fact-based political thriller “12.12: The Day” dominated the Korean box office for the third successive weekend and advanced its takings haul beyond $50 million. It was far ahead of “Napoleon,” which opened a disappointing third. The Kim Sung-soo-directed picture earned $11.4 million between Friday and Sunday, accounting for 75.8% of nationwide weekend cinema revenues, according to data from Kobis, the tracking service operated by the Korean Film Council (Kofic). It has held up particularly strongly and dropped by only 12% in its third weekend.

Han So-hee, Park Seo-jun face off in ‘Gyeongseong Creature’ trailer

Gyeongseong Creature, starring Han So-hee and Park Seo-jun.Set in the spring of 1945, Gyeongseong Creature will follow several individuals in the city of Gyeongseong – which was the colonial name for Seoul city during the Japanese rule over Korea – as they go up against monstrous creatures born out of human greed.Park Seo-jun will play Jang Tae-sang, the wealthiest and most attractive man in the Bukchon district, who has a penchant for insider information. Meanwhile, Han So-hee will portray Yoon Chae-ok, a skilled todugun (bounty hunter and sleuth who tracks down the missing).The brand-new trailer for Gyeongseong Creature previews the first, tense meeting between Tae-song and Chae-ok, as well as their initial visit to the mysterious Ongseong Hospital.

‘Battle in the Box’ Korean Game Show Format Unpacks Further International Deals – ATF

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Something Special, the Seoul-based international format agency founded by format specialists Jin Woo Hwang (president and executive producer) and Kim In Soon (EVP & head of content) announce that ITV Studios has optioned the hit Korean celebrity format “Battle in the Box” for France, Australia, New Zealand, and Israel. The deal was unveiled on Wednewday, the first full day of the Asia Television Forum and Market (ATF) in Singapore. “Battle in the Box,” created by Korea’s NMedia and represented globally by Something Special, has previously seen deals announced with Fremantle for Denmark, Norway, Sweden, Finland, the Netherlands, Belgium and Portugal.

Korea Box Office: Political Thriller ‘12.12: The Day’ Enjoys $13 Million Second Weekend Haul

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Political drama thriller “12.12: The Day” dominated the South Korean box office for a second weekend with a $13 million haul. Its second weekend outing topped its first session, when it earned $11.2 million, according to data from Kobis, the tracking service operated by the Korean Film Council (Kofic). And the film (aka “Seoul Spring”) increased its share of the weekend’s total cinema market to a crushing 81%. Separately, ComScore calculated that the film’s single country receipts made it the seventh highest grossing film in the world over the weekend. After two weekends on release, “12.12: The Day” has garnered $34.2 million, making it already the sixth ranking film in Korea this year and the third biggest Korean-produced picture.

Ex-SM Entertainment CEO launches new agency, plans to debut six K-pop acts by 2028

SM Entertainment CEO Nikki Semin Han has established a brand-new music label, with plans to debut six new K-pop acts by 2028.According to an exclusive report by Variety, Han has teamed up with a group of former colleagues from SM Entertainment to launch Titan Content, a newly established music label based in the US. The agency described itself to Variety as “the world’s first premier multinational K-pop powerhouse music company”, with facilities in both Los Angeles and Seoul with the goal of breaking their upcoming roster of artists into the US music market.According to Variety, Titan Content is currently working on launching two K-pop girl groups, two boy groups, a male soloist and a female soloist by 2028.

INFNITE’s Nam Woo-hyun opens up about “rare” cancer diagnosis

Nam Woo-hyun of K-pop boyband INFINITE has opened up about his “rare” cancer diagnosis.Nam Woo-hyun revealed his gastrointestinal stromal tumor (GIST) diagnosis during a new interview with The Korea Times, where he opened up about it being an “extremely rare form of cancer” and how it faced it.“In my case, the urgency of surgery was non-negotiable, so I quickly held my fan events and performances in January and February before undergoing surgery [in April],” the singer said, before revealing that “the scale [of the cancer] was more extensive than I had thought”.“After the surgery, I had to refrain from drinking water for almost three weeks and got a 20-centimeter scar on my stomach,” the INFINITE singer added. “I even had to attach a blood bag.”However, Nam Woo-hyun also touched on how his time in the hospital, in particular his interactions with the “caring” nurses, had inspired him “to recover, release new music and pursue my passion as a singer”.“I feel as if I were reborn after the surgery,” he said.
